Does it snow on the Egyptian pyramids and if so, do you have a picture?

No it doesn't. It hardly ever snows in Egypt.

Make your mind up! Either "no it doesn't" or "it hardly ever" does.
I gather it snowed in the Sahara desert in 1981, but snow in a lowland desert region like the Nile valley is certainly rare.
There is a theatrical production called "It Doesn't Snow In Egypt", but that is wrong. It does in the mountains:
